Bautista focuses work on suspension settings and improving confidence in Mugello test
After a difficult race weekend in Mugello the San Carlo Honda Gresini Team stayed for the one-day test at the Italian circuit on Monday to try to resolve the problems they had encountered during the weekend and improve the riders’ confidence. The team didn’t receive any new parts from Honda to test, but worked through different suspension settings and tested out the soft tyre which they couldn’t use during the race on Bridgestone’s orders.
With asphalt temperatures over 50°C, Álvaro Bautista did a total of 49 laps with the soft tyre, finding more confidence on the bike compared with the harder option which the team had to use on Bridgestone’s advice during the weekend. But still it wasn’t easy for the Spaniard to quickly find a good pace again as he had to regain his confidence after being well down the order for the whole weekend, struggling to find the right setup for the hard tyres and suffering three crashes in three sessions while dealing with the issue of a dangerous brake failure. He was also still feeling the aftereffects of his collision with Casey Stoner during Sunday’s race, as he suffered from some pain in his elbow where Stoner’s bike had hit him, but he managed to post 22 laps within the 1.48’5s, with a best lap of 1.48’530 which meant 9th position overall at the end of the day. A pity, because the race would have been much more consistent for Álvaro with this setting, but the Talaverano was still happy, because he successfully worked to make further progress with the Show suspension ahead of the next race in the USA.
After the test session ended, the team packed up the 18 crates with the bikes and all materials which are now on their way to Laguna Seca where the next Grand Prix will take place on July 29th.
